:Ossido di manganese (MnO2)
Descrizione:
Ossido di manganese (MnO2) è un solido nero o marrone che si verifica naturalmente come il minerale pirolusite, che è il minerale principale del manganese. È un composto inorganico caratterizzato dal suo alto stato di ossidazione del manganese, dove il manganese è nello stato di ossidazione +4. MnO2 è insolubile in acqua ma può dissolversi negli acidi, formando sali di manganese. Questo composto presenta proprietà paramagnetiche a causa della presenza di elettroni spaiati nei suoi orbitali d. Viene comunemente utilizzato come catalizzatore in varie reazioni chimiche, inclusa la decomposizione del perossido di idrogeno, e come pigmento in ceramiche e vetro. Inoltre, il MnO2 svolge un ruolo significativo nelle batterie, in particolare nelle batterie alcaline, dove funge da depolarizzatore. La sostanza è anche utilizzata nella produzione di altri composti di manganese e nei processi di trattamento delle acque reflue. Le considerazioni di sicurezza includono il suo potenziale di causare irritazione respiratoria per inalazione e irritazione della pelle per contatto, richiedendo misure di gestione appropriate.
